Beyond credential theft, cracked software is also a primary method for distributing ransomware and cryptominers. According to cybersecurity experts at Barracuda, malicious actors embedded in software cracks can lead to "ransomware, credential theft, cryptominers, session hijacking, and software compromise". Ransomware can encrypt all of your files, including irreplaceable photos and documents, and hold them hostage for payment. Cryptominers, on the other hand, run silently in the background, consuming your computer's processing power and electricity to generate cryptocurrency for the attackers.
